About this cause

William Langford Community House is a World Communities Centre, and we provide a variety of programs and services that support and empower the community to grow, dream, learn and contribute. We provide a variety of programs including after school groups, English classes, computer for seniors, arts and crafts and cooking and a number of services including emergency relief, food relief and mental health referral. 

The 2023 Foodbank Hunger Report* stated that 3.7million households, thats 36%, reported experiencing moderate to severe food insecurity, with 79% of those repoprting that increased/ high living expenses as the reason. We all know within our own families and homes that the cost of living has spiralled and for those families receiving low incomes or suffering mortgage or rental stress, this is having a deeper impact.

 

This month, we are raising funds to increase our reach into the community with providing food parcels and essential toiletries, often the first things people cut back on, with the money received. Just in time for the end of the financial year, you can assist us to support those in the community who need a hand up, especially at a time when the temperature starts to drop, heating costs begin to rise and a warm meal or drink is much more appreciated.

Our food support program, when available is provided to families, couples, singles and the homeless when requested. A $25 donation can allow us to provide a family with an essential toiletries pack; $50 will provide a family with a number of warm dinners; $75 will provide a couple with a week of warm dinners; $100 will provide a family with a wek of warm dinners. 

Supporting a local neighbourhood house like ours,  may not change the world but it could change the world for someone.
